Output d8e4297c6da5d827fbc378973f9af01f884cdd17c8a30d95c8f4c46d8fe67d64:3

value
276021394
script pubkey
OP_0 OP_PUSHBYTES_20 5a7704368eccccb9dccd73cc9e3acd52939429c2
address
bc1qtfmsgd5wenxtnhxdw0xfuwkd22feg2wzfnhl02
transaction
d8e4297c6da5d827fbc378973f9af01f884cdd17c8a30d95c8f4c46d8fe67d64
confirmations
288798
spent
true